CD4+ T-cell effectors inhibit Epstein-Barr virus-induced B-cell proliferation
S Nikiforow1, K Bottomly, G Miller
1Department of Immunobiology, Yale University School of Medicine, New Haven, Connecticut 06520, USA.
CD4+ T cells prevent rapid proliferation of Epstein-Barr virus (EBV)-infected B cells. This immune surveillance is crucial for controlling early-stage EBV-driven B-cell growth, unlike later stages controlled by CD8+ T cells.
Area of Science:
- Immunology
- Virology
- Cell Biology
Background:
- Epstein-Barr virus (EBV) can cause B-cell lymphoproliferative disease and lymphoma in immunodeficient individuals.
- Immortalized B-cell lines readily form in vitro without immune surveillance.
- Memory T cells inhibit EBV-transformed B-cell foci in regression assays.
Purpose of the Study:
- To identify the specific T-cell subset responsible for regulating the early proliferative phase of EBV-infected B cells.
- To analyze T-cell surveillance mechanisms governing EBV-mediated B-cell proliferation using quantitative methods.
Main Methods:
- Quantitative analysis of T-cell surveillance on EBV-infected B cells.
- In vitro infection of B cells with EBV and assessment of proliferation.
- Manipulation of T-cell populations (CD4+ and CD8+) to determine their role in immune control.
Main Results:
- CD4+ T cells significantly limit the proliferation of newly infected, activated CD23+ B cells.
- In the absence of T cells, EBV-infected CD23+ B cells exhibit rapid division within the first three weeks post-infection.
- Removal of CD4+ T cells, but not CD8+ T cells, abrogated immune control over early B-cell proliferation.
- Purified CD4+ T cells effectively inhibited the outgrowth of EBV-infected B cells in vitro.
Conclusions:
- CD4+ effector T cells are essential for preventing the early proliferative phase of EBV-induced B-cell growth.
- This contrasts with the role of CD8+ cytolytic T cells in eliminating established EBV-infected lymphoblastoid cell lines.
